Understanding Vitamin D3: The Sunshine Vitamin
Vitamin D is unique among nutrients. While we can consume it through certain foods like fatty fish or egg yolks, our primary "natural" source is actually the skinâs reaction to ultraviolet (UVB) radiation from the sun. This is why it has earned the nickname the "sunshine vitamin." Once produced in the skin or absorbed through the digestive tract, it undergoes conversion in the liver and kidneys to become an active hormone.
At Cymbiotika, we believe that understanding the "why" behind your supplements is the first step toward true empowerment. Vitamin D3 (cholecalciferol) is the form our bodies naturally produce and is widely considered more effective at raising and maintaining blood levels compared to Vitamin D2 (ergocalciferol). It may support a variety of functions, including:
- Immune System Support: Helping the body maintain its natural defenses.
- Bone Health: Aiding in the absorption of calcium, which is essential for skeletal strength.
- Muscle Function: Assisting in the maintenance of healthy muscle tissue.
- Mood Regulation: Supporting a balanced state of mind and emotional resilience.

Morning vs. Evening: The Timing Debate
Many people wonder if there is a "golden hour" for Vitamin D3. Letâs break down the advantages of different times of day.
The Case for Morning Supplementation
For a large majority of our community, the morning is the ideal time to take Vitamin D3. There are several practical and biological reasons for this:
- Alignment with Circadian Rhythms: Because Vitamin D is naturally produced in response to sunlight, taking it in the morning may align better with the body's natural internal clock. Some research suggests that Vitamin D levels are naturally higher during daylight hours.
- Habit Stacking: It is often easier to remember a supplement when it is part of a morning ritual. Whether you take it alongside your Liposomal Vitamin C or your morning coffee, consistency is easier to maintain when you start your day with intention.
- Meal Integration: As we will discuss further, Vitamin D3 is fat-soluble. Most people eat a more substantial meal with healthy fats for breakfast or lunch than they do for a late-night snack.
The Evening Consideration
Some individuals prefer taking their vitamins in the evening, often because that is when they take other minerals like our Magnesium Complex. While it is certainly not "bad" to take Vitamin D3 at night, there are a few things to keep in mind.
Some preliminary studies have suggested a potential link between high-dose Vitamin D supplementation late at night and a decrease in melatonin production. Melatonin is the hormone responsible for signaling to your body that it is time to sleep. If you find that your Liposomal Sleep routine isn't as effective as you'd like, you might want to try moving your Vitamin D3 to earlier in the day to see if it makes a difference.
Key Takeaway: If you are sensitive to changes in your sleep patterns, morning or early afternoon is generally the preferred window for Vitamin D3.
The Fat-Soluble Factor: The Most Important Rule
Regardless of the time you choose, the non-negotiable rule for Vitamin D3 absorption is that it must be taken with fat.
Vitamin D3 is fat-soluble, meaning it does not dissolve in water. To move from your digestive system into your bloodstream, it requires the presence of dietary lipids. Taking Vitamin D3 on an empty stomach or with just a glass of water can significantly reduce its absorptionâsometimes by as much as 50%.
To maximize the benefits, try taking your Vitamin D3 with:
- Avocados
- Nuts and seeds
- Eggs
- Full-fat yogurt
- Healthy oils (like olive or coconut oil)
- A high-quality fatty acid supplement like The Omega

Individual Factors: Age, Skin Tone, and Location
Your personal "best time" and "best dose" may vary based on several factors. At Cymbiotika, we emphasize transparency and education so you can tailor your routine to your specific needs.
Age and Absorption
As we age, our skin becomes less efficient at synthesizing Vitamin D from sunlight, and our digestive tracts may become less efficient at absorbing nutrients. Older adults may find that they need a more bioavailable delivery method, such as liposomes, to maintain healthy levels.
Skin Melanin
Melanin acts as a natural sunscreen. While this is wonderful for protecting the skin, it also means that individuals with darker skin tones require more time in the sun to produce the same amount of Vitamin D as someone with lighter skin. For those with higher melanin levels, consistent year-round supplementation is often helpful.
Geographical Location
If you live in a northern latitude (anywhere above the "37th parallel"), the sun's rays are not strong enough during the winter months to trigger Vitamin D production, no matter how much time you spend outside. In these regions, many people find that increasing their support during the darker months helps maintain Immunity and mood balance.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I take Vitamin D3 on an empty stomach?
While you can, it is not recommended for optimal results. Vitamin D3 is fat-soluble and requires dietary fat to be absorbed efficiently by the body. Taking it with a meal containing healthy fats can significantly improve how much of the vitamin actually reaches your bloodstream.
2. Is it better to take Vitamin D3 daily or once a week?
Many healthcare professionals suggest that daily supplementation is more effective for maintaining steady, consistent blood levels than taking a single large dose once a week. Daily habits also make it easier to incorporate the supplement into your routine and ensure it is paired with daily meals for better absorption.
3. Will Vitamin D3 keep me awake if I take it at night?
Some individuals report that taking Vitamin D3 late in the evening can interfere with their sleep quality, potentially due to its interaction with melatonin production. If you are sensitive to sleep disruptions, it is generally best to take your Vitamin D3 in the morning or early afternoon.
4. How much Vitamin D3 is too much?
While Vitamin D is essential, it is possible to take too much, as it is stored in the body's fat tissues. Most health organizations suggest that 4,000 IU per day is the safe upper limit for most adults unless otherwise directed by a healthcare professional. It is always a good idea to have your blood levels tested regularly and to consult with a provider if you are pregnant, breastfeeding, or taking other medications.
